Corrosion-Resistant Casters Essential for Harsh Environments
Mar 31 , 2026In industries ranging from food processing to marine applications, corrosion-resistant casters are essential components. These specialized products withstand exposure to moisture, chemicals, and harsh cleaning agents while maintaining reliable performance.
The Corrosion Challenge
Corrosion poses significant challenges in many environments:
Food processing facilities requiring frequent washdowns with harsh sanitizers
Chemical plants exposed to corrosive substances and fumes
Marine environments with constant salt spray and humidity
Outdoor applications facing rain, snow, and temperature extremes
Medical facilities using aggressive disinfectants
Standard casters quickly deteriorate in these conditions, leading to premature failure, contamination risks, and safety concerns.
Materials for Corrosion Resistance
Manufacturers employ various materials to combat corrosion:
Stainless Steel
Stainless steel is the material of choice for demanding applications. Different grades offer varying levels of corrosion resistance:
304 stainless steel suitable for most food and medical applications
316 stainless steel offering superior resistance to chlorides and chemicals
17-4 PH stainless steel providing high strength with excellent corrosion resistance
Protective Coatings
For carbon steel casters, protective coatings extend service life:
Zinc plating offering basic corrosion protection
Nickel plating providing enhanced durability
Powder coating creating a tough, corrosion-resistant barrier
Galvanizing delivering heavy-duty protection for outdoor use
Engineered Polymers
Advanced plastics and composites resist corrosion entirely while offering other benefits including light weight and quiet operation.
